and the info for the release translated from Portuguese to English:
2011 was the best year of Sinewave . Fired.
I do not have numbers yet, want to generate a report in early 2012. But the reasons are: a) We launched twelve works of exceptional quality. We have never received so much resonance - blogs, Brazilians and gringos sites, newspapers, social networks, all disks have affected in some way. And the most fun this December is to follow the Best of the Year lists - many of them highlighting works released by the label b) produce four editions of Sinewave Festival in cities such as Curitiba, Porto Alegre and Rio de Janeiro, with bands of the casting and invited . All editions promised making the noise, and c) Everything that was derived from these two items above.
All this in music betting "wrong." Ships paraphrase Jair, who on the last day 15/dez gave a speech in honor of Herod, a band that opened his show: "They are guys who believe in what they do, even doing a job with no commercial appeal." Extend it to all the bands that started their work with us this year, all of which are part of our history, and all orbiting around the seal and not part - or at least not yet.
So this Sinewave Essentials - The Best of 2011 . A like the most, either through a click or feel that increasingly rare "but how come I never heard that before?", and every effort will be worth it. Work here because each has something besides the default - is punch, is a different idea, or more elaborate, genius is something unreasonable, something that is confusing to follow the aesthetic of "because".
HUEY , LAVALSA , DISASTER THE TAPE , THIS LONELY CROWD , ALMA MATER , THE MACHINE ON , Solemn UPPSALA , NOISE / MM , TEAM.RADIO , SUM , KALOUV . Eleven bands from all parts of Brazil, ranging from metal to post-rock experimental indie loud the spleen with violins, the shoegaze pop appeal with the post-industrial.
All this is to pave the next year - more albums, more gigs, more festivals, more noise than in 2011. Because 2012 will be the best year of Sinewave. Fired.
